Name: Forrest Approximate breed: Lab mix Gender: Male Approximate age: 1.5 years Approximate weight: TBD lbs Vetting/Vaccinations: Up to date Spayed/Neutered: Yes Good with Children: Yes Good with Dogs: Yes Good with Cats: Unknown Housetrained: Yes Crate Trained: Unknown Ideal Family: Any Adoption Fee: $550 Forrest was saved from euthanasia a few months ago by our rescue friends down south, but sadly, adoptions are at a near standstill down there and overpopulation of un-neutered/spayed animals keeps growing so this sweet boy wasn't getting noticed. We are happy to help our devoted rescue friends by freeing up a space and bringing him up north, where we know there are many loving, pampering homes that are looking for a 4-legged family member. Sweet Forrest has been enjoying home and family life while in foster care, and although he is shy upon meeting new humans and dogs, he thoroughly enjoys their company after proper intros. He makes an excellent companion! He has been good with his southern foster's kids, and walks gently on leash. He does ok once in a car, but he is very scared of getting in and has to be lifted in. He was found as a stray in an area where it's not uncommon for people to drive their dogs far out and dump them to fend for themselves - this is just a guess at his past but we're hoping that the trust and positive reinforcement of a loving family can help re-write whatever made the poor pup scared <3 His southern foster says he is a very good boy and an all-around cool dog to have by your side! We are a nonprofit organization - all adoption fees go towards the rescue, veterinary care, and transportation of these dogs in order to get them ready for their forever homes. We are a shelterless rescue. All of our dogs are housed in foster homes to help them de-stress and get used to a home environment while they await adoption, giving us the opportunity to understand their personalities and needs.
